Carlo Gavazzi WM12-96.AV5.3.3.S End-of-Life Information

Key Conclusion: This model together with the entire WM12 series was officially discontinued in April 2020. The official replacement is the WM15 series, while the WM14 series can be used as a temporary transitional replacement.

  1. Official EOL Basis

Carlo Gavazzi officially released an announcement in April 2020:

With the launch of the new WM15, the WM12, WM14, and EM26 are discontinued.

As a 96×96mm panel-mounted three-phase multifunction power indicator in the WM12 series, WM12-96.AV5.3.3.S is included in this full-series discontinuation.

  1. EOL Timeline & Replacement Arrangement
Time NodeEventOsservazioni
Apr-20WM15 series launched; WM12 series officially discontinuedOfficial EOL (End of Life) Date
Before DiscontinuationWM14 series as upgraded replacement for WM12WM14-96AV533S is direct drop-in replacement for WM12-96.AV5.3.3.S
After April 2020WM15 series becomes final successor to WM12/WM14Maggiore precisione (Classe 1 kWh) and added functions such as harmonic analysis
  1. Key Information of Replacement Products
  2. Direct Drop-in Replacement:

WM14-96AV533S (WM14-96×96 400/660V 5AAC 18-60VDC SERIAL)

Identical 96×96mm panel size and mounting method

Same AV5 range: 380/660V L-L / 5(6)A AC

Same 18-60VDC power supply and RS485 communication

  1. Final Upgraded Replacement: WM15 Series

Accuracy upgraded to Class 1 for active energy

Added harmonic distortion measurement

Supports single/two/three-phase and wild-leg systems

Optional pulse output, Modbus RTU or M-Bus communication

  1. Acquisto & Raccomandazioni per la manutenzione
  2. Stock Status: Only limited second-hand or surplus stock available; brand new original units are nearly out of stock.
  3. Maintenance Support: Carlo Gavazzi generally provides 6 years of spare parts support for discontinued models.
  4. Model Migration: New projects are recommended to adopt the WM15 series directly; existing projects can use the WM14 series for transitional upgrading.

Replacement Analysis of WM12-96.AV5.3.3.S and WM12-96.AV5.3.3.X

Conclusione fondamentale: The two models are physically and hardware compatible and can be directly interchanged for installation; however, there is a key difference in communication functions. Their interchangeability depends on whether the system requires RS485 communication.

  1. Core Difference Comparison (Only One Distinction)
ModelloDifferenza chiaveFunctional ImpactApplication Limitation
WM12-96.AV5.3.3.SWith RS485 serial communication (S=Serial)Supports communication with host computer/PLC via Modbus RTU protocol for remote monitoring and data acquisitionSuitable for automation systems requiring centralized monitoring
WM12-96.AV5.3.3.XWithout RS485 communication (X=No Serial)Only local LED display available; remote data reading not supportedSuitable for simple applications requiring only on-site parameter viewing

All other parameters are completely identical:

Modello basso: WM12-96 (96×96mm panel mounting, with built-in programming keypad)

Range code: AV5 (380/660V L-L / 5(6)A AC)

System type: 3 (1/2/3-phase system, unbalanced load)

Tipo di alimentazione: 3 (18-60VDC power supply)

Identical measurement accuracy, electrical specifications, physical dimensions and ingress protection rating

  1. Interchangeability Feasibility Judgment

2.1 ✅ Applicable Interchange Scenarios (Bidirectional)

System does not require RS485 communication: The X model can directly replace the S model, saving cost while fully meeting on-site display requirements.

Temporary replacement only: Either model can be used as a temporary spare part for fault maintenance without affecting basic measurement and display functions.

New project design: Selection based on actual communication demand; hardware mounting dimensions and wiring are fully compatible.

2.2 ❌ Non-interchangeable Scenarios (Unidirectional Restriction)

Modello originaleTarget ModelReason for Non-interchangeabilitySoluzione
S (With Communication)X (Without Communication)The system relies on RS485 remote monitoring; communication will be interrupted after replacementKeep S model, or upgrade to communication-enabled WM15 series
X (Without Communication)S (With Communication)No communication wiring or host interface in the system; the communication function cannot be usedNo need for replacement, or upgrade after completing communication infrastructure
  1. Key Points for Replacement Operation

3.1 Installazione fisica

Exactly the same 96×96mm panel cutout size, direct plug-and-play replacement.

Consistent terminal definition; no modification required for main circuit and power wiring.

Same ingress protection level (Front IP65, Terminal IP20) with consistent environmental adaptability.

3.2 Function Configuration

The built-in programming keypad operates identically; original parameter settings can be copied directly.

Fully compatible in measurement parameters, display modes and alarm threshold configuration.

When replacing X with S, additional configuration of RS485 address (1-255) and communication parameters (9600bps, 8N1) è obbligatorio.
